How to fill out electrical contractors license

How to fill out electrical contractors license:
01
Research the requirements: Start by researching the specific requirements for obtaining an electrical contractors license in your state or region. Each jurisdiction may have different criteria, so it is important to understand what is needed.
02
Complete the application: Once you have gathered all the necessary information and documentation, fill out the application form provided by the licensing authority. This form typically includes personal information, experience details, and any other relevant information required by the authority.
03
Provide supporting documents: Along with the application, you may be required to submit supporting documents. These can include proof of education or training, documentation of previous electrical work experience, and any relevant certifications or licenses.
04
Pay the application fee: Most licensing applications require a fee to be paid. Ensure that you have the necessary funds available to cover this cost. The fee amount can vary depending on the jurisdiction and the type of license being applied for.
05
Schedule and pass the examination: In many cases, an examination is required to demonstrate your knowledge and skills in electrical work. Schedule the examination at a convenient time and ensure that you have adequately prepared for it. Passing the examination is usually a prerequisite for obtaining an electrical contractors license.
06
Submit the application: Once you have completed all the necessary steps, submit the application along with any required supporting documents and payment. Make sure to double-check that all information is accurate before submitting to avoid any delays or complications.
Who needs electrical contractors license:
01
Electricians: Electrical contractors licenses are typically required for electricians who wish to operate as independent contractors or start their own electrical contracting businesses. This license allows electricians to legally offer their services to the public.
02
Electrical contracting businesses: If you own a business that provides electrical services, having an electrical contractors license is usually a legal requirement. It ensures that your business operates according to the laws and regulations governing electrical work, protecting both you and your clients.
03
Construction and renovation companies: Many construction and renovation projects require electrical work to be carried out. In order to bid on and carry out these projects, a construction or renovation company may need to have an electrical contractors license.
04
Homeowners: Some jurisdictions require homeowners to hire licensed electrical contractors for certain types of electrical installations or repairs. This is to ensure that the work is done safely and meets the necessary codes and regulations.
Overall, obtaining an electrical contractors license is crucial for individuals and businesses involved in electrical work. It not only ensures compliance with legal requirements but also demonstrates a level of expertise and professionalism in the field.

What is electrical contractors license?
An electrical contractor's license is a certification that allows individuals or companies to legally perform electrical work.
Who is required to file electrical contractors license?
Electricians, electrical contractors, and companies that specialize in electrical work are required to obtain and file an electrical contractor's license.
How to fill out electrical contractors license?
To fill out an electrical contractor's license, individuals or companies must complete the required application form, provide proof of qualifications or experience, and pay the necessary fees.
What is the purpose of electrical contractors license?
The purpose of an electrical contractor's license is to ensure that individuals or companies performing electrical work have the necessary skills, knowledge, and qualifications to do so safely and effectively.
What information must be reported on electrical contractors license?
Information such as the name and contact information of the contractor or company, proof of qualifications or experience, and possibly proof of insurance may need to be reported on an electrical contractor's license.
